So, I bought all the parts for my new PC. Shelled out almost 2900 dollars for it. I needed an OS, so I bought Windows 8.1. I, however, did not buy a Disc Drive, as I was already about 100 dollars over budget, and couldn't get it in.

I was told I could install windows 8.1 through USB, but, apparently, to do that... I need a access to a disc drive, so I can create an ISO of the disc. However, my Macbook Pro doesn't have a disc drive... so that's not at all helpful, as you can imagine.

When I asked around other places, no one really gave me an answer that would work for me. Mainly, they kept saying borrow a computer from someone... but I'm new to the city I live in, and don't really know anyone yet, except a couple of school mates, who happen to only have the same Macbook I have, which doesn't have a Disc Drive.

What I'm trying to figure out is what I can do. It would suck if I paid all that money for a computer I won't be able to use. Could any of you help me at all?
